Charge (Japanese: じゅうでん Charge) is a non-damaging Electric-type move introduced in Generation III.

Contents

Effect

Generation III

If the user's next move is Electric-type, it will deal twice the usual amount of damage. This only applies to damage dealing moves of the Electric-type.

Generation IV

The effects of Charge are the same as the previous generation; however, Charge also raises the user's Special Defense by one stat level.

Trivia

  • Along with Volt Tackle, Charge is the only Electric-type move exclusive to Electric-type Pokémon. However, Volt Tackle is itself, a move exclusive to Pikachu's evolutionary line, whereas Charge can be learned by many Electric-types.
